Understanding Protection Methods
Understanding the different protection methods your lawyer could utilize is important to effectively browsing your instance. Each strategy rests on the specifics of the charges you're encountering and the proof against you. Let's look into what you need to recognize.
First off, if there's a lack of evidence, your legal representative could argue that the prosecution hasn't satisfied its burden of proof. Keep in mind, it's not your work to show virtue; it's the prosecutor's job to verify guilt beyond a practical uncertainty. If they can't, you should be acquitted.
One more usual strategy is self-defense, particularly in cases entailing charges like attack or homicide. If you were shielding on your own, your attorney might use this method to warrant your actions legally. This requires showing that your understanding of hazard was reasonable which your reaction was in proportion to that threat.
Sometimes, your protection may include doubting the legality of exactly how proof was gotten. If police breached your legal rights during the examination, proof could be subdued, which can significantly damage the prosecution's case.
Lastly, your attorney might work out a plea bargain if it serves your best interest. This normally occurs if the evidence versus you is strong however there are mitigating variables that could cause decreased charges or sentencing.
Recognizing these methods assists you review your situation better with your legal representative.
